How they compare
UNICEF: Western Europe currently reports 0.9447 GPIA against 0.4876 GPIA in Republic of Moldova, a difference of 0.4571 GPIA.
That makes UNICEF: Western Europe's figure about 1.9 times Republic of Moldova's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was UNICEF: Western Europe ahead.
Republic of Moldova ranks 99th and UNICEF: Western Europe ranks 99th of 129 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Republic of Moldova averaged higher in 1 and UNICEF: Western Europe in 1.
